WebGout is a type of inflammatory arthritis that causes pain and swelling in your joints, usually as flares that last for a week or two, and then resolve. Gout flares often begin in your big toe or a lower limb. Gout happens when high levels of serum urate build up in your body, which can then form needle-shaped crystals in and around the joint. Web9 nov. 2024 · People with gout experience intense episodes, called flares, of inflammation, swelling, heat, and severe pain in the affected joints. Early in the disease, gout flares usually last a few days to several weeks. Over time, episodes occur more often and last longer as some people develop a chronic form of gout, called gouty arthritis.

Most people who take allopurinol do not get any serious side effects. However, some side effects of allopurinol include: rashes. headaches. feeling drowsy or dizzy. feeling or being sick. changes to your sense of taste. If you develop a rash, redness or flu-like symptoms, you should contact your doctor straight away.
